Jaws 08-26-2013 07:12 PM

Oh sorry. I didn't exactly mean a cheaper setup cuz I really line your reactors. I just mean if you didn't have room to setup 4 or 5 different reactors, which strains of phyto would you say are better to use instead of others.

mameroo2000 08-26-2013 07:24 PM

Quote:

Originally Posted by Jaws (Post 841018)
Oh sorry. I didn't exactly mean a cheaper setup cuz I really line your reactors. I just mean if you didn't have room to setup 4 or 5 different reactors, which strains of phyto would you say are better to use instead of others.

Nannochloropsis is easy to culture as its need minumum mantinant
Isochrysis need strong light
This two phytoplanktons are the best in breeding fry fish , and for reef tank

mameroo2000 08-26-2013 09:44 PM

Quote:

Originally Posted by HaZRaTTy (Post 841035)
Hey,

I was at frag fest and have seen the posts and pictures of your setup and I'm quite impressed. Do you culture Rotifers? Also curious about the phyto seems everyone is culturing there own these days. How many systems of yours are kicking around the city and what do you do to reduce crashes?

I'm am toying with the idea of trying my hand in raising some clown fry from my clownfish just to try to challenge myself.

I'm not sure how many system kicking around as I never account them lol.
I do have 12 phytoplankton reactors running with 6 different species off phytoplankton , I do culture Rotifers , 3 species copepods, amphipods and brine shrimps .
My next project is breeding live mysis as I'm working on my mysis system .
To avoid phytoplankton crash u will need to sterilize everything, to/DI water, equpment .
I use pure alcohol to sterilize all my equpment after that washe it with hot tap water , the alcohol will evaporate on 30c temp .
My RO/DI I use ozoneizer for about 5~10 minut before use .
I'm planing on adding uv sterilizer to my RO/DI unite outlet to avoide the ozone.
